Ingredients
- 8 ounce linguine pasta
- 1 pound beef sirloin, thinly sliced
- 4 tablespoon butter
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 14 ounce crushed tomatoes
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h basil leaves for garnish
Instructions
1. 1. Begin by boiling a large pot of salted water. Once boiling, add the linguine pasta and cook according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. 2. In a large skillet over medium heat, melt 2 tablespoon of butter. Add the thinly sliced beef and season with salt and pepper. Sauté the beef for about 5 minutes, or until browned. Once cooked, remove it from the skillet and set aside.
3. 3. In the same skillet, add the remaining 2 tablespoon of butter along with the minced garlic. Sauté for 1 to 2 minutes until the garlic is fragrant but not browned.
4. 4. Pour in the can of crushed tomatoes and add the heavy cream. Stir well to combine and let the mixture simmer for 5 minutes.
5. 5. Next, add the grated Parmesan cheese and Italian seasoning to the skillet. Mix until the cheese has melted and the sauce is creamy and smooth.
6. 6. Return the cooked linguine and sautéed beef to the skillet. Toss everything together gently, ensuring all the pasta and beef are coated with the rich, creamy sauce.
7. 7. Serve your Garlic Butter Beef Linguine hot, garnished with fresh basil leaves and an extra sprinkle of Parmesan cheese if desired.
Notes
Feel free to substitute the beef sirloin with flank steak or ribeye for a different taste, and use a gluten-free pasta if you prefer a gluten-free option!
